Hi Lee. The door latch assy. is part # WPW10130695. You can buy the door striker part # is WPW10119337, and use it to toggle the door switches shut/on and open/off. This will free up your hands to electrically check the door switches. Make sure the unit is level front to back and side to side. All 4- legs touching the floor snugly so the door /latch don't get cocked under a full heated load in the tub. This in turn breaks switches, control panels and latch assy. Thank you.

Lee, First check and make sure both the door switches and wiring operate properly. Check and make sure the new touchpad ribbon is not twisted, kinked, or creased, and properly installed to the control board connection. Otherwise you'll need a new control board WPW10218822. Good Luck and Thanks

Hello Eric. These are not hard to change. First disconnect the power to the unit. Then remove the screws holding the inner door panel in place. Remove the inner door panel and the cover over the control board. Remove the ribbon cable from the control board, and remove the control board housing from the door. Then remove the screws holding the control panel in place. Reinstall in reverse order. Make sure the ribbon cable is seated properly on the control board. Hope this helps.

Hello Kim. These are not to hard to install. You will need to disconnect the power going to the unit. Then remove the inner door panel. Remove the ribbon cable going to the control board. Next remove the screws holding the control board in place. Then remove the screws holding the control panel in place. Reinstall in reverse order. Hope this helps.
